Went with 2 teenage kids for the day. We arrived early, about 15mins before opening and recommend getting here early and ideally prepurchasing your tickets to avoid the heavy queues. The place is understandably huge and has a spot for all family types or visitors. We chose the Zen Pool area which has no rides or slides and meant it wasn't as loud or busy as the rest of the park. It was only a 1 min walk to any water slide. The kids had a blast, we had fun as adults too, there is a good mix of slides - could do with 1 or 2 more because as an adult or even teen you can only do 1 ride so many times and the queues get longer throughout the day. Lifeguards are everywhere which is great to see and usually 3 or 4 per slide depending on the size of it. The Wave probably had the most because of the risk of you aren't a particularly strong swimmer.
There are snack bars around the park but only 2 restaurants but still sufficient. Pricing and portions were good. A great day to enjoy the sun if you want something different to the beach for a change. There are lockers at the front entrance to store valuables (3eur for the day) and a shop which is a little pricey to be fair selling snacks, clothing and souvenirs. All in all not bad.

This ranks as one of the worst waterparks that I've visited. There are very few slides here, and if your children are under 1.4m / 12 years old, that diminishes to just 3 slides / areas for them.
The lifeguards are a mixed bag. Some are really great and help kids to have a good time. Others are whistle-happy and obstructive, to the point of craziness. They'll give people about 3 seconds to get clear of the bottom of a ride before throwing a fit with the whistle.
Then there are the local teenagers (who the lifeguards don't whistle at). The local teens basically run riot through the pools, crashing into people and behaving like idiots. Our two kids who're 7 & 5 were getting quite intimidated by this.
The crazy river counts as one of the worst I've ever seen. It's designed to give you a few spills, which is fine as that's part of the fun. Unfortunately when it was built the pools that you're supposed to spill in were only made about 30cm deep, so you will smack your head into the bottom of the pools sooner or later. Our kids went down it once, then told me they didn't like it because of bumped heads.
Avoid - there are better water parks around.
